Let's try to invoke the Setup Wizard without using the menu.
1. From the Command window, run this command:
Do Wizard.app.
(This steps assumes you have the default folder set to the VFP home folder.)
Can you choose the Setup Wizard from this list?
2. If that does not work, navigate to the VFP6\Wizards folder and DO
WZsetup.app. This is the Setup Wizard itself. Does this work?
To fix this problem, you might want to follow the steps in this article
that shows how to delete and recreate the Wizard.dbf and Wizard.fpt files.
See 114721 PRB: Error Occurs When Starting a Wizard
http://support.microsoft.com/?id=114721
